Today’s Encouragement is Matthew 6:9 NLT [Jesus said, ] “Pray like this: Our Father in heaven, may your name be kept holy.”
Our Father –
Our relationship with God is defined in multiple ways throughout the Bible. Often, He is the shepherd, we are His sheep; He is The Holy One immeasurably high above all peoples; He is like a potter, and we like clay; and various other similes and metaphors are provided to enable us to understand the nature of our relationship.
And the best, highest, most accurate revelation of our relationship with Him?
Our Father.
Jesus made this clear in addressing prayer to Our Father, leaving no question about Him as Father and us as His family, the true sons and daughters of the Living God!
Many of us may have difficulty with a father image. Our earthly fathers may have been very good examples of the nature of a Father. They may have been absent, abusive, or neglectful… Such that our concept of ‘father’ is seriously damaged. The idea of a deep emotional wound, called ‘The Father Wound’ has been widely acknowledged by psychologists in recent decades.
Yet my friend, God is our Perfect, Loving, Eternal, Kind, Wise, Forgiving, Omnipotent, Omniscient, Omnipresent, and personally knowable Father! And He has provided, through Christ, The Only Way for us to be in true, unashamed, unafraid, peaceful, and loving relationship with Him. He loves you and me that much!
